COW

In the organizer's words:

GBR 2023, documentary film, 94 min.

Director: Andrea Arnold.

Language: without dialog.

Oscar-winning director Andrea Arnold (AMERICAN HONEY, FISH TANK) returns with COW, a captivating portrait of the life of a dairy cow named Luma. The film team followed the cow from Park Farm in the English county of Kent intermittently over a period of four years.
Arnold unflinchingly depicts the details of Luma's daily life, from grazing on green pastures to giving birth, producing milk and everything in between. Unadulterated and unsparingly honest, Arnold's latest work shows the impact of humans in their relationship and dependence on other animals.

The screening is part of the exhibition IN THE BEGINNING WAS WATER.
